Ruthie Jane was recently rescued just-in-time out of a kill shelter in South Alabama. Fortunately for Ruthie our Dudley's family heard her need and helped to save her life. Ruthie thus far is a great gal. Good with other dogs, cats and people and has a wonderful desposition. She is also a funny girl! Loves to play. Knows simple commands and eager to learn more! Very smart! Learned how to use the doggy door in less than 5 minutes! She loves the water! Loves to fetch. NEVER had an accident in the house. She's crate trained and house trained!
Ruthie is Lab/ German Short Hair Pointer mix it appears, but vet said mostly Labbie, a rich chocolate color approx. close to one years old and 59 pounds, heart worm negative, up-to-date on her shots and will soon be spayed and microchipped.
